Differential Effects on Cell Fusion Activity of Mutations in Herpes Simplex Virus 1 Glycoprotein B (gB) Dependent on Whether a gD Receptor or a gB Receptor Is Overexpressed

Glycoprotein B (gB) of herpes simplex virus (HSV) is one of four glycoproteins essential for viral entry and cell fusion. Recently, paired immunoglobulin-like type 2 receptor (PILRα) was identified as a receptor for HSV type 1 (HSV-1) gB. Both PILRα and a gD receptor were shown to participate in HSV...
